Sat 1346545429213130

decimal
328618.429213130
degree
0°118618′10″429213130‴
percentile
64.1212109854443%
name
ehszubrodzz
cycle
0
epoch
1
period
163
block
328618
offset
429213130
timestamp
rarity
common